Runbook: Faregrid pricing experiment rollout. 1) Freeze the experiment config in the Tollbooth repo. 2) Confirm the 60/40 traffic split in the Splitwise dashboard. 3) Build the pricing bundle and run the holdout sanity check. 4) Sign the bundle before pushing to the Meridian CDN. All experiment artifacts must be signed or the gate rejects them. Use the team signing key shown below.

signing key of hahag-tahag = bky4_v18e

ALERT: CatalogueImportStalled — the Marrowfield library catalogue import has made no progress for 30 minutes. Likely causes: malformed MARC batch from the nightly feed, or the ingest worker stuck on a duplicate-record lock. Check the ingest queue depth first; if it's growing, pause the feed and requeue the failing batch. Do not restart the database. Imports are idempotent, so reprocessing is safe. Step-by-step recovery instructions are on the internal page below.

wiki page, hahif-hahif: https://argocd.kelvisys.corp/browse/board/settings/pages/1442e0b1065d83f1

## Runbook: Monthly partition roll (LedgerBarn)

Every month-end, LedgerBarn's events table needs a fresh partition before midnight UTC, or inserts start landing in the overflow partition and dashboards get weird. The roll job usually handles it, but if you're reading this it probably didn't fire. Run the partition script manually, then verify the new partition shows in the catalog. The script reads these values at startup.

service settings:
[casax]
port = 6379
team = rusir
host = casax.zemvarhq.corp
region = outer-4
access_code = ac_9808ce
timeout_ms = 1500

## Authentication

The Scanbridge integration authenticates against the internal Quillport service on every scan batch upload. Tokens are not interactive — there is no login flow, no refresh endpoint, and no session state. Each request must carry the static service key in the request header; a missing or stale key returns a 401 and the scanner gateway will queue batches locally for up to six hours. If you're on call and see a 401 storm, rotate and redeploy. The current key is below.

gateway credential: kto3_qfe